Handing an ancient society a modern machine would have achieved nothing: the Romans could neither have built a steam engine nor found a profitable use for one.

    If you had given the Romans the designs for a Newcomen steam engine, they couldn’t have built it without developing whole new technologies for the purpose (or casting every part in bronze, which introduces its own problems) and then wouldn’t have had any profitable use to put it to.
